Medical arrangements for the protection of Simla against Plague
Scope & Content:
pp 623-29. Correspondence between the Governments of India, the Punjab, and Bombay. Provides details of observation posts and medical officers selected for plague duty.
Construction of a new Provincial Lunatic Asylum at Lahore
Scope & Content:
pp 737-71. Correspondence regarding the construction and proposed establishment of the new asylum, including plans and elevations, plus conference proceedings and statements showing the comparative cost of a new asylum against the cost of modifications to existing arrangements.
Engagement of ten doctors for temporary plague duty in India
Scope & Content:
pp 1403-19. Correspondence, plus details of the ten doctors [name, qualifications, posting]; extract of an article published in The Lancet of 27 May 1899, critical of the treatment of those on temporary plague duty; plus copy [blank] Memorandum of Agreement form.
pp 67-69. Secretary of State for India forwards three letters from Captain F Warren, Royal Navy, proposing a scheme for the manufacture and transport of ice in India, and discussing his alleged arrangements with the Government of Spain. Plus memorandum thereon by the Army Sanitary Commission.

Cultivation of sunflowers in the Dutch East Indies
Scope & Content:
pp 77-78. British Minister at the Hague forwards a translation of a report on the cultivation of sunflowers in several of the Residencies in Java and Madura, for the purposes of neutralizing marshy exhalations.

Trial of cinchona febrifuge in the Madras Presidency
Scope & Content:
pp 75-79. Correspondence regarding trials of the cinchona febrifuge from Sikkim, and its possible substitution for 75 percent of the supply of quinine in Madras Presidency.
